Nestled in the historic county of Pembrokeshire, Tenby station welcomes travelers with a blend of traditional charm and practical conveniences.
Tenby station is a modest yet efficient hub for travelers. Though it lacks a ticket office, the presence of ticket machines ensures that purchasing and collecting your tickets is a breeze. These machines are well-equipped to accommodate major debit and credit card payments, making your travel preparations seamless. Although induction loops are available to aid communication, you won’t find waiting rooms, toilets, or refreshment facilities on the premises.
When it comes to onward travel, Tenby station has you covered. While there are no direct cycle hire facilities, you can rely on convenient connections like buses and other local transport links. For any rail disruptions, a handy rail replacement bus service is stationed right at the entrance, minimizing inconvenience.
Tenby station is designed to accommodate a variety of needs. With step-free access to several areas and a platform ramp available, those with mobility challenges will find it easier to navigate through the station. If assistance is needed, passengers can call ahead to the helpline or use the Passenger Assist service for planning and support. Whilst staff help isn't readily available on site, calling ahead ensures you have all the assistance you might need.

Nestled in the lush landscapes of Carmarthenshire, Llandovery Train Station is a charming, small stop on the Heart of Wales Line. It serves as a portal to the picturesque Welsh countryside, ready to offer you a warm and rural welcome. If you're planning a trip to or from Llandovery, being informed about the station’s facilities and services is an invaluable part of ensuring a smooth journey.
Llandovery presents a simple and quaint stop with limited facilities, highlighting its serene setting. The station does not have a ticket office or any ticket machines, compelling passengers to purchase their tickets online or through mobile apps. For those who require online ticket purchasing assistance or general help, you can rely on the customer helpline available at 08002006060. Despite its size, Llandovery offers some essential support such as step-free access on parts of the station to assist travelers with mobility difficulties. Access to platforms is conveniently facilitated by a level crossing.
As for waiting amenities, there is no waiting room; nonetheless, there is comfortable seating available to rest while awaiting your journey. Although facilities like toilets, shops, and refreshment services are missing, the lovely surrounding countryside might just tempt you to step out and explore the area.
Getting around from Llandovery is easily manageable with its accessible transport links. Although there are no bicycle hire facilities at the premises, reaching the station is possible with the available rail replacement bus service situated right at the entrance. The station also supports eight wheelgrip bike stands for cycle enthusiasts keen on exploring the serene Welsh paths. It's worth pre-planning to access further transportation options like local taxi services to take you deeper into the Welsh heartlands.
